Yes you can. The exchange rate between American and Bahamian currency is $1 to $1. Because of the high percentage of American tourists that travel to the Bahamas and the strong influence of the American culture, many if not all establishments and businesses accept US$.

The term "Bahamian" is pronounced as "buh-HAY-mee-uhn." It refers to something related to the Bahamas, including its culture, people, and language. The adjective describes anything pertaining to this Caribbean nation, while the noun refers to its citizens.
